RWA Tokenization is becoming a practical way for businesses to represent ownership or economic rights connected to physical and financial assets through blockchain-based tokens. Real estate, private credit, commodities, funds, artwork, infrastructure, and other asset classes can be represented digitally under suitable legal and regulatory structures. For businesses planning a tokenization venture in 2026, development cost is only one part of the budget. Legal work, asset verification, smart contracts, investor onboarding, compliance, custody, marketplace functions, blockchain infrastructure, security testing, and ongoing maintenance can all affect the final investment.

The cost of developing an RWA platform can vary widely because every project has different asset types, jurisdictions, user groups, blockchain requirements, and trading models. A basic token issuance platform may require a considerably smaller budget than a full marketplace supporting asset issuers, institutional investors, retail users, secondary trading, compliance checks, and multiple token standards. This guide explains the major cost areas businesses should consider before planning an RWA tokenization project in 2026.

What Is RWA Tokenization Development?

RWA tokenization development involves creating the technical and business infrastructure required to represent real-world assets as blockchain-based tokens. The process usually includes asset onboarding, ownership or rights verification, token creation, smart contract development, investor management, compliance workflows, wallet connectivity, transaction processing, and reporting.

The project may be developed as a private platform for a single organization or as a public marketplace where different asset issuers can list tokenized assets. Estimated RWA Tokenization Development Cost in 2026

A reasonable development budget depends on the platform's functions and business model. For planning purposes, businesses can consider the following broad ranges:

Platform TypeApproximate Development Budget
Basic RWA token issuance platform$25,000 to $50,000
Mid-level tokenization platform$50,000 to $100,000
Full RWA marketplace$100,000 to $200,000+
Institutional-grade multi-asset platform$200,000 to $400,000+

These figures are indicative rather than fixed quotations. A platform operating across several jurisdictions may require a much larger budget because legal review, compliance procedures, identity verification, custody arrangements, reporting, and integrations can add substantial expenses.

Businesses should therefore calculate the expected cost according to their planned features rather than selecting a development package based only on the initial software price.

Main Factors That Affect RWA Tokenization Development Cost

Asset Type and Tokenization Model

The asset selected for tokenization has a direct effect on development requirements. A real estate platform may need property documentation, valuation records, ownership verification, rental income records, and investor distribution functions. A private credit platform may require loan records, repayment schedules, borrower information, and yield calculations.

The tokenization model also matters. Businesses can issue tokens representing ownership interests, revenue rights, debt claims, fund interests, or other legally defined rights. Each structure can require different smart contract logic and administrative workflows. Real World Asset Tokenization therefore needs to be planned around the asset's legal and financial structure before technical development begins.

Blockchain Network Selection

Blockchain infrastructure can influence both initial and recurring expenses. Businesses may choose networks such as Ethereum, Polygon, BNB Chain, Avalanche, Arbitrum, or a private or permissioned blockchain depending on their requirements.

The selection should consider transaction fees, ecosystem support, wallet compatibility, token standards, transaction speed, developer availability, and regulatory requirements. Supporting multiple networks can increase development and testing work because contracts, wallet connections, transaction monitoring, and user interfaces may need additional configuration.

Smart Contract Development

Smart contracts manage many functions associated with tokenized assets. Depending on the platform, contracts may handle token issuance, ownership records, transfers, distributions, redemption, voting, whitelisting, and other rules.

Development costs can increase when contracts contain complex restrictions or financial calculations. Businesses should also allocate money for independent smart contract audits. An audit may identify coding issues before deployment and can be particularly important when substantial investor funds may interact with the contracts.

Compliance and Investor Verification

Compliance can represent a major part of an RWA project budget. A platform dealing with investment-related assets may require KYC and AML procedures, investor eligibility checks, sanctions screening, transaction monitoring, jurisdiction restrictions, and document collection.

Businesses may integrate third-party identity verification and compliance providers instead of developing every function internally. The cost can include integration fees, subscription charges, transaction-based pricing, legal consultations, and periodic compliance reviews.

Cost of Essential Platform Features

Asset Issuance Module

An issuance module allows authorized asset issuers to create and manage tokenized offerings. Typical functions include asset information, documentation, token supply, pricing, investor limits, offering periods, and issuance records.

A basic issuance module may be relatively affordable, while a multi-asset system with approval workflows and detailed reporting can require considerably more development time.

Investor Dashboard

The investor interface can include portfolio information, token balances, transaction history, investment documents, distributions, asset details, and account settings. Institutional investors may also need reporting tools, permission controls, downloadable records, and organization-level account management.

The number of user roles and dashboard functions can affect development cost. A simple investor interface requires less work than a platform supporting issuers, investors, administrators, compliance teams, custodians, and auditors.

Marketplace and Secondary Trading

Businesses planning to create a marketplace should budget separately for listing, order management, trading rules, settlement, pricing information, transaction history, and asset availability controls.

Secondary trading can also introduce additional regulatory and technical considerations. If the platform permits peer-to-peer transfers, the system may need eligibility checks before a token can move from one wallet to another. This makes marketplace development more complex than a basic token issuance application.

Wallet and Custody Integration

Users need a secure method for holding and transferring tokens. A platform may support external wallets, embedded wallets, custodial wallets, or a combination of these approaches.

Institutional platforms may require additional custody integrations and approval workflows. The development budget should include wallet APIs, transaction monitoring, recovery procedures, permission management, and testing.

Cost of Legal, Compliance, and Asset Verification

Technical development does not establish legal ownership by itself. Businesses need suitable legal structures that connect blockchain tokens with rights associated with the underlying asset.

Legal expenses can include company structure, token classification, offering documents, investor agreements, asset ownership arrangements, jurisdictional analysis, regulatory consultation, and compliance policies. Asset verification may also involve valuation reports, title checks, financial records, third-party attestations, and documentation reviews.

For this reason, Real World Asset Tokenization Services commonly involve coordination between technology teams, legal advisors, financial professionals, asset owners, and compliance specialists. Businesses should keep a separate legal and regulatory budget rather than treating these expenses as part of software development.

Security and Testing Expenses

Security testing should receive a dedicated budget. RWA platforms can contain smart contracts, wallets, payment functions, APIs, databases, identity information, and administrative controls. Each component can introduce different security concerns.

A development team may conduct functional testing, integration testing, smart contract testing, penetration testing, access-control testing, API testing, and performance testing. Independent audits can add another expense, but they can be useful before a platform handles real assets or investor transactions.

Post-Launch Maintenance Costs

The budget should not end when the platform goes live. Businesses should plan for server infrastructure, blockchain node services, monitoring, security updates, bug fixes, third-party API subscriptions, compliance updates, technical support, and feature additions.

Annual maintenance may commonly fall around 15% to 25% of the initial software development cost, although the actual amount depends on the platform's size and operating model. A multi-marketplace system with several integrations will usually require more ongoing technical attention than a basic issuance platform.

How Businesses Can Control RWA Development Costs

Start With a Defined MVP

A minimum viable product can help businesses test their concept before committing to a large platform. The initial version may include asset onboarding, token issuance, investor registration, wallet integration, compliance checks, an administrator dashboard, and basic reporting.

After receiving market feedback, additional marketplace functions, asset categories, trading features, and integrations can be added. This approach can help avoid spending heavily on features that may not be needed during the first market phase.

Select Features According to the Business Model

Not every RWA platform needs every available function. A company focused on tokenized real estate may require property management and income distribution features, while a private credit platform may need repayment tracking and borrower data.

Businesses should first define how assets enter the platform, how investors participate, how tokens are held, how income is distributed, and how tokens can be transferred or redeemed. The software requirements can then be mapped to these activities.

Compare Development Approaches

Businesses can choose among custom development, ready-made solutions, white-label platforms, or a hybrid approach. Custom development provides greater control but generally requires more time and resources. White-label solutions can reduce initial development work, while hybrid models combine existing components with project-specific functions.

Typical Budget Breakdown for an RWA Platform

For a mid-level project with a development budget of around $75,000 to $150,000, a possible allocation could look like this:

Cost AreaApproximate Share
UI/UX and frontend10% to 15%
Backend development15% to 20%
Smart contracts10% to 15%
Blockchain integration8% to 12%
Wallet and payment integrations5% to 10%
KYC/AML and compliance integrations5% to 10%
Security testing and audits8% to 12%
Admin and reporting functions5% to 10%
Deployment and infrastructure3% to 7%
Maintenance and supportSeparate annual budget

These percentages are planning estimates. The actual allocation can change depending on whether the project uses third-party services, multiple blockchains, institutional custody, secondary trading, or complex asset structures.

Why Businesses Should Plan Beyond Development

The initial software invoice does not represent the complete cost of operating an RWA business. Marketing, customer acquisition, legal services, compliance staff, asset sourcing, insurance, custody, banking relationships, licensing, audits, and customer support can all require separate budgets.

Businesses should also consider transaction fees and third-party service charges. KYC providers, blockchain infrastructure providers, payment processors, custody platforms, analytics systems, cloud services, and communication tools may charge recurring fees based on usage.

Conclusion

RWA Tokenization development costs in 2026 can range from tens of thousands of dollars for a basic issuance platform to several hundred thousand dollars for a marketplace serving institutional and retail participants. The final budget depends on asset type, token model, blockchain network, smart contracts, compliance requirements, investor functions, custody, marketplace features, security testing, integrations, and ongoing maintenance. Businesses should define the first release carefully, separate technical expenses from legal and operational costs, and reserve funds for post-launch support. FAQs

1. How much does RWA Tokenization development cost in 2026?

A basic RWA platform may cost around $25,000 to $50,000, while a mid-level platform may range from $50,000 to $100,000. Larger marketplaces and institutional systems can exceed $200,000 depending on their features and compliance requirements.

2. What factors have the biggest effect on RWA platform development cost?

Asset type, blockchain selection, smart contract complexity, compliance requirements, investor features, custody, marketplace functions, integrations, and security testing can have a major effect on the total budget.

3. Does RWA development include legal and compliance expenses?

Not always. Software development quotations may cover technical work only. Legal structuring, regulatory consultation, licensing, KYC and AML services, asset verification, and related professional services may require separate budgets.

4. How much does smart contract development cost for an RWA project?

The price depends on contract complexity and the number of contracts required. Basic token contracts may cost less, while contracts handling transfers, restrictions, distributions, redemption, voting, or other financial rules require additional development and testing.

5. Can businesses launch an RWA platform with a smaller initial budget?

Yes. Businesses can begin with an MVP containing only the functions required for the first market phase. Additional asset types, investor features, trading functions, and integrations can be added later based on business requirements.

6. What are RWA Tokenization Services?

RWA Tokenization Services can include asset token design, smart contract development, blockchain integration, platform development, wallet connectivity, investor dashboards, compliance integrations, testing, deployment, and maintenance.

7. Is RWA Tokenization suitable for real estate assets?

Real estate is one possible use case because properties can be represented through suitable legal and financial structures. However, the token must have a legally defined relationship with ownership, revenue, debt, or another asset-related right.

8. What is included in RWA token development?

RWA token development can include token standards, smart contracts, issuance logic, transfer restrictions, wallet compatibility, distribution rules, administrative controls, and integration with the broader tokenization platform.

9. Should businesses choose custom development or a ready-made platform?

The choice depends on budget, timeline, business model, and required functions. Custom development may suit businesses needing specific workflows, while ready-made or white-label options may reduce initial development requirements.

10. Why is security testing important for RWA platforms?

RWA platforms can handle valuable assets, investor records, wallets, and financial transactions. Security testing can help identify weaknesses in smart contracts, APIs, authentication systems, access controls, and other platform components before wider use.
